Ingredients
1cupfull fat cottage cheese
1cuppumpkin puree
2tbspunsweetened almond milkor heavy cream for classic keto
Add cottage cheese and pumpkin to a food processor, blend until smooth or use a large bowl and electric hand mixer to blend.
Sprinkle gelatin powder over almond milk in a small bowl and heat in microwave for 30 seconds, stir until dissolved. Set aside.
Add collagen and pumpkin spice, vanilla extract and sweetener to the processor and process until smooth. Taste and adjust sweetener of choice before proceeding.
Drizzle in gelatin and blend once more until incorporated.
Pour into 4 serving glasses and refrigerate for at least 1 hour or more. If overnight, cover with plastic wrap.
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days.
